Transaction 83335614d59accd66888032fa5dca5ea2a1a8f74d7bbdfc71dcf9141f68edff3

1 Input
2 Outputs
  • 83335614d59accd66888032fa5dca5ea2a1a8f74d7bbdfc71dcf9141f68edff3:0
  • value  23790
    address  1Fd5WMMV5hQxYrMqDoCmmM24H4RNmj4PRs
  • 83335614d59accd66888032fa5dca5ea2a1a8f74d7bbdfc71dcf9141f68edff3:1
  • value  174364
    address  1ByBB3EwUFHkrPfsNAKxCSzo1HuvaDGkpu